  1. Geospatial One-StopVersion 2 Award Coordination Working Group Meeting February 8, 2005

  2. GOS Portal Version 2 Procurement Milestones  October 14-15 -- GovWorks finalizes RFP for issuance  October 18, 2004 -- RFP issued  October 27 -- Pre-bidders' conference at DOI in Reston, VA  November 2 -- Amended SOW/formal question answers  Nov 15, 2004 -- Proposals Due  Nov 15 - 26 -- CO reviews/preps proposals for technical review  Nov 29 - Dec 10 -- Technical Reviews and scoring of proposals  Dec 15, 2004 -- Technically acceptable proposal demos Jan 31, 2005 -- Award Contract • May 2, 2005 – Version 2 deployment

  3. Contract Options • CLIN 1 Develop & Integrate • CLIN 2 Deploy, Operate & Maintain • CLIN 3 Develop & Implement Enhancements • CLIN 4 Optional Web Hosting

ESRI – Spatial Google – Search Engine IBM – Portal Safe Software – Interoperability and Standards Image Matters – Interoperability and Standards Northrop Grumman – Interoperability and Standards SNVC – Security, Certification & Accreditation Dataline – Portlets UC San Diego Supercomputer – Usability/Portlets Team Members

  5. New Features • Intuitive GIS novice & first-time user experience using the Google paradigm • True JSR portal user interface using IBM’s WebSphere • Portlet implementation so GOS Catalog search can be included in others’ portal applications • Greater OGC interoperability • 5-second or faster response to queries • Web-based channel management tool • Extensive performance statistics
